THE COLOR
I received the color “Steel Reserve” which is a pretty accurate description of the color. It’s a deep steel gray color that is absolutely gorgeous on. I would probably reserve this color more for the fall and winter months as I tend to like bright colors for summer.

STAYING POWER
This polish lasts!! I painted my nails on Sunday (my usual paint day) and used a base coat and topcoat of Nail Envy by OPI and by the following Sunday there was barely a chip to be seen!

The next time I tried out the inserts was in a pair of flats
These are a pair of my favorite flats but they can sometimes hurt my feet and give me blisters, so I figured what better pair to test them out in! And, I have to say that my feet felt AMAZING!! They were so comfortable that I didn’t even feel the need to change my shoes when I got home from church (which is normally the first thing I do).
VERDICT: Definitely a must for flats!
The only thing I’m interested to see is how many uses I can get out of this one set of insoles. They do have a sticky undercoating which is why I was able to switch them between shoes. I’m going to keep rotating them out to see how long it takes to lose the stick and will try to remember to update this post to let you know the results!
My overall view is that these are definitely a necessity for my beloved flats and I’m sure that they are equally as wonderful for high heels.

CND Almond Soothing Creme
This lotion smells AMAZING!! It smells like almonds (obviously) but there is also a slightly sweet scent to it that kind of reminds me of homemade icing. I apply it right after I wash my hands because I have insane dry skin (especially on my hands) and this makes them feel instantly soft.
REPURCHASE POWER: Yes

Dove Nourishing Body Wash (Deep Moisture)
This is hands down my favorite body wash. I use the Deep Moisture formula because as stated above I have really dry skin. I also like that it isn’t scented because I layer it with scented body washes. And, yes I know that you can buy Dove scented body washes, but I don’t feel like those give me the moisture my skin needs so I just layer.
REPURCHASE POWER: Honey, I buy this stuff in BULK!
